@charset "UTF-8";
/* CSS Document */

#wrapper{
	width:960px;
	margin:0 auto;
	background-image:url(../../../images/main/zentai_haikei.png);
}

.menu{
	width:900px;
	height:auto;
	margin:0 auto 80px;
}



#top{
	width:860px;
	/*padding:0px 10px;*/
	margin:0 auto;
	margin-bottom:20px;
	text-align:center;
}

#story{
	background-image: url(../../../images/main/b080.jpg);
	width:820px;
	margin:0 auto;
	position:relative;
	box-shadow:5px 5px 5px rgba(0,0,0,0.4);
	border-radius:10px;
}


.main1_ue1{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-1_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;	
}

.main1_sita1{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-1_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;  bottom:0px;	
}


#main1{
	background-image: url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-1_tate.png");
	background-repeat:repeat-y;
/*	background-repeat:no-repeat;*/
	width:820px;
	height:auto;
	padding:50px 10px 60px 10px;
	margin:0 auto;
/*	margin-top:50px;
	margin-left:100px; 
	margin-bottom:30px;*/
	text-align:center;
}

#main2{
	background-image: url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-3_tate.png");
	background-repeat:repeat-y;
/*	background-repeat:no-repeat;*/
	width:820px;
	height:auto;
	padding:50px 10px 60px 10px;
	margin:0 auto;
/*	margin-top:50px;
	margin-left:100px; 
	margin-bottom:30px;*/
	text-align:center;
}

.main2_ue2{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-3_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;	
}

.main2_sita2{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-3_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;  bottom:0px;	
}


#main3{
	background-image: url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-4_tate.png");
	background-repeat:repeat-y;
/*	background-repeat:no-repeat;*/
	width:820px;
	height:auto;
	padding:50px 10px 60px 10px;
	margin:0 auto;
/*	margin-top:50px;
	margin-left:100px; 
	margin-bottom:30px;*/
	text-align:center;
}

.main3_ue3{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-4_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;	
}

.main3_sita3{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-4_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;  bottom:0px;	
}

#main4{
	background-image: url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-2_tate.png");
	background-repeat:repeat-y;
/*	background-repeat:no-repeat;*/
	width:820px;
	height:auto;
	padding:50px 10px 60px 10px;
	margin:0 auto;
/*	margin-top:50px;
	margin-left:100px; 
	margin-bottom:30px;*/
	text-align:center;
}

.main4_ue4{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-2_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;	
}

.main4_sita4{
	background-image:url("../../../images/sekaiheiwa/01_main_yorokondesuru/pattern1-2_yoko.png");
	width:700px;
	height:60px;
	margin:0 auto;
	position:absolute; left:60px;  bottom:0px;	
}


#title{
	width:520px;
	height:auto;
/*	margin-left:100px;
	margin-top:150px;*/
	margin:100px auto 0px;
	font-size:90%;
	line-height:2.5em;
}

#penname{
	width:200px;
	margin-top:10px;
	margin-left:450px;
}

#content{
	width:580px;
	height:auto;
/*	margin-top:20px;
	margin-left:75px;*/
	margin:20px auto;
	padding-bottom:100px;
	font-size: 16px;
	line-height:25px;
	letter-spacing: 0.1em;
}

#content1{
	width:450px;
	height:auto;
	margin-top:20px;
	margin-left:160px;
	text-align:center
}
#content p{
	margin-left:0px;
	text-align: left;
}
	
#content1 p{
	text-align:left;
}

.top_modoru{
	width:200px;
	text-align:center;
	position:absolute; right:80px; bottom:80px;
/*	float:right; */
	margin-top:0px;
	margin-right:5px;
	margin-bottom:0px;
}
.print{
	position:absolute; right:70px; bottom:70px;
}
.home_modoru{
	wedth:200px;
	float:left;
	margin-top:40px;
}

.ai_link:visited{
	color:#690;
}


.ai_link:hover{
	color:#F60;
	text-decoration: underline;
}
